Zero exclusion criteria based on client choice: People are not excluded based on readiness, diagnoses, symptoms, substance use history, psychiatric hospitalizations, homelessness, level of disability, or legal system involvement.
Integration of rehabilitation and mental health services: IPS programs are closely integrated with mental health treatment teams.
Attention to worker preferences: Services are based on each person’s preferences and choices.
Personalized benefits counseling: Employment specialists help people obtain personalized, understandable, and accurate information about their social security, Medicaid, and other government entitlements.
Systematic job development: Employment specialists systematically visit employers to learn about their business needs and hiring preferences.
Time-unlimited and individualized support: Job supports are individualized and continue for as long as each worker wants and needs the support.
Fidelity and Evaluation
The Center of Excellence for Behavioral Health provides fidelity reviews of our practices of focus. A fidelity review is a quality-improvement tool to provide agencies an external evaluation of their practice for the purpose of service enhancement.
